基于常规试验设备的HASS技术在航空电子产品上的应用  被引量:7

摘  要:高加速应力筛选(HASS)技术是一种新型的试验技术,试验效率高,能有效保障产品的可靠性。介绍了高加速应力筛选的基本原理和典型的HASS过程,然后将HASS应用于某航空电子产品,提出了一种基于常规试验设备的HASS方案。根据环境应力筛选(ESS)与基于强化试验设备的HASS技术,给出了基于常规试验设备的HASS初始剖面制定过程,并从理论上验证了该剖面的有效性,筛选验证结果表明该剖面具有安全性。Highly Accelerated Stress Screening (HASS) is an emerging reliability test technology. With high efficiency, HASS can effectively guarantee reliability of product. The fundamental principle and the typical process of HASS were introduced. A HASS scheme based on routine test equipment was proposed and applied to a certain avionics. According to the technologies of Environmental Stress Screening (ESS) and HASS based on enhancement test equipment, the HASS initial profile was designed, and the validity of the HASS initial profile was proved in theory. The validation result showed that the HASS initial profile is safe.
